Types of Medical Malpractice Cases

February 16, 2012 by Robbins Law, P.C.

Medical malpractice occurs when a medical professional delivers negligent care that results in an injury to the patient. There are many different types of medical malpractice cases which can be filed against doctors, nurses, hospitals, and other medical professionals. Some of the most common include:

  • Anesthesia errors – Anesthesia is an important part of many medical procedures, but when administered improperly, the results can be catastrophic. Anesthesiologists must monitor you throughout the procedure to make sure you do not experience any adverse reactions to the anesthesia. Failure to do so can result in medical malpractice.
  • Birth injuries – Sadly, medical errors during delivery result in birth injuries more often than we would like to think. Common birth injuries caused by medical malpractice include cerebral palsy and Erb’s palsy.
  • Failure to diagnose cancer – Early diagnosis of cancer is critical to your chances of a successful recovery. When a doctor fails to diagnose your cancer accurately or in a timely manner, you may be entitled to receive compensation for any additional damages suffered as a result of this delayed diagnosis.
  • Medication errors – Common examples of medication errors include the wrong medication being prescribed, the wrong dosage being prescribed, failure to foresee potential complications, and illegible prescriptions.
  • Emergency room errors – Emergency rooms are fast paced environments that often deal with life-or-death situations. When emergency room errors occur, the results can be catastrophic for the victim.
  • Surgical errors – All surgical procedures are associated with certain risks. However, when a surgical error during any phase of the procedure results in an injury, you may be entitled to receive compensation for your damages. Examples include operating on the wrong site, leaving a surgical instrument inside the patient, or operating on the wrong patient.

If you have suffered an injury caused by medical malpractice, you may be entitled to receive compensation for your damages.
